The CUET PG General Test for 2025 will be conducted between 13th May and 3rd June, and students can access the question paper, answer key, and solution PDF after the exam. The test evaluates a candidate’s overall aptitude, including verbal ability, quantitative reasoning, general awareness, logical reasoning, and data interpretation.
Candidates are required to solve 75 questions in 60 minutes, with a maximum of 300 marks. Each correct response earns 4 marks, and 1 mark is deducted for every incorrect answer.
